Module 1 (Day 1): Mastering the Foundations of Effective Coaching
In this intensive first day, participants will immerse themselves in the core foundations of coaching excellence.
They will not only learn the theory, but actively practice and embody the essential competencies and mindsets that distinguish impactful coaches.
Key Focus Areas:
- Understanding the psychology and neuroscience of coaching: why coaching transforms behavior and thinking.
- Distinguishing between coaching, mentoring, managing, and consulting — and when to apply each.
- Deep dive into the Core Coaching Competencies (trust building, presence, active listening, powerful questioning, creating awareness, and fostering accountability).
- Learning and practicing structured coaching conversations using proven models (e.g., GROW Model and advanced adaptations).
- Building the inner stance of a coach: emotional regulation, humility, curiosity, and resilience.
Methodology:
- Short theoretical bursts followed by immediate practice.
- Triad simulations (Coach-Coachee-Observer rotation).
- Real-world cases and debriefs.
- Facilitated peer feedback to accelerate skill development.
By the end of Module 1, participants will confidently structure and run a real coaching conversation, applying foundational skills that can immediately be integrated into leadership and workplace interactions.
Module 2 (Day 2): Expanding Coaching Impact — Contexts, Challenges, and Professionalization
Building on the foundation of Day 1, the second day focuses on strategically applying coaching skills across diverse contexts, handling complex coaching challenges, and exploring the path to professional coaching for those who seek it.
Key Focus Areas:
- Coaching for Performance: Enhancing team productivity, accountability, and motivation without micromanagement.
- Coaching for Conflict and Difficult Conversations: Using coaching skills to mediate, resolve tensions, and foster understanding.
- Coaching for Innovation and Change: Unlocking new thinking patterns, creativity, and adaptability in teams.
- Embedding Coaching into Leadership: Moving from "doing" coaching to "being" a coaching-centered leader.
- Exploring Coaching as a Profession:
- Overview of professional coaching certifications (ICF, EMCC, etc.).
- How to start building a coaching portfolio.
- Ethical considerations and maintaining coaching integrity.
- Positioning yourself as a coach within or beyond your organization.
Methodology:
- Simulation labs across different coaching contexts.
- Critical incidents: participants will coach each other through real-world leadership dilemmas.
- Reflective journaling on coaching challenges and strengths.
- Personal strategic plan: How to embed coaching into career and leadership journey.
By the end of Module 2, participants will have a clear roadmap on how to integrate coaching into their leadership style — and, if desired, how to take their coaching skills to the next level professionally.
